一、技术演进背景:对话模型与任务执行的范式转换
当前主流对话模型在自然语言理解领域已取得突破性进展,但企业级应用场景中仍面临三大核心挑战:任务边界模糊导致执行结果不可控、上下文依赖复杂引发输出稳定性问题、结果审计缺失造成业务风险难以追溯。
以某电商平台智能客服系统为例,传统对话模型在处理”订单取消并退款”这类复合任务时,需通过多轮对话收集用户信息,再调用多个后端服务完成操作。这种耦合式设计不仅导致系统复杂度指数级增长,更因模型输出随机性引发20%以上的操作失败率。
MoltBot的出现标志着AI工程化进入新阶段。其核心设计哲学在于:将对话能力作为任务执行的入口而非终点,通过标准化任务接口、结构化上下文管理和确定性执行引擎,构建起可审计、可追溯、可约束的智能体架构。
二、核心架构解析:模型能力与工程约束的黄金平衡
1. 三层解耦架构设计
MoltBot采用独特的”模型-适配器-执行器”分层架构:
- 模型层:提供基础推理能力,支持主流大语言模型的快速接入
- 适配器层:实现任务模板解析、上下文状态管理、输出格式转换
- 执行器层:对接企业业务系统,完成API调用、数据库操作等确定性任务
# 示例:任务适配器伪代码class TaskAdapter:def __init__(self, model_instance):self.model = model_instanceself.state_manager = ContextState()def parse_intent(self, user_input):# 意图识别与参数提取passdef generate_action_plan(self, intent):# 生成可执行的任务序列return [{"type": "api_call", "endpoint": "/orders", "method": "GET"},{"type": "db_update", "table": "payments", "condition": {...}}]
2. 确定性执行引擎
通过引入任务状态机和操作原子化设计,MoltBot确保每个业务动作都可追溯:
- 将复杂任务拆解为不可分割的原子操作
- 维护全局任务状态图谱
- 实现操作回滚与异常恢复机制
某金融机构的测试数据显示,该设计使复杂业务流程的执行成功率从68%提升至99.2%,操作审计效率提高40倍。
3. 动态约束管理系统
MoltBot提供多维度的行为约束机制:
- 输入约束:通过正则表达式或JSON Schema验证用户输入
- 输出约束:定义允许的响应格式和内容范围
- 流程约束:限制可调用的API接口和操作权限
// 约束配置示例{"allowed_apis": ["/orders/*", "/payments/refund"],"output_schema": {"type": "object","properties": {"status": {"enum": ["success", "failed"]},"transaction_id": {"type": "string"}}}}
三、工程化实践指南:从开发到部署的全链路优化
1. 任务建模方法论
有效任务建模需遵循SMART原则:
- Specific:每个任务应有明确边界
- Measurable:定义可量化的成功标准
- Achievable:匹配模型当前能力边界
- Relevant:紧密关联业务核心价值
- Time-bound:设置合理的超时机制
以”处理客户投诉”任务为例,正确建模应包含:
- 情绪识别子任务
- 投诉分类子任务
- 解决方案推荐子任务
- 人工转接判断子任务
2. 提示词工程进阶
MoltBot提出三段式提示词结构:
[上下文约束]当前任务:{task_name}可用工具:{tool_list}执行限制:{constraints}[输入数据]{user_input}[输出模板]请返回JSON格式结果:{"action": "api_call|db_query|...","params": {...},"next_step": "continue|finish|escalate"}
这种结构使模型输出稳定性提升3倍以上,减少60%的无效重试。
3. 监控运维体系
构建完善的观测体系需关注四大维度:
- 任务指标:成功率、平均耗时、重试次数
- 模型指标:响应延迟、token消耗、拒绝率
- 系统指标:资源利用率、错误日志、依赖服务状态
- 业务指标:成本节约、效率提升、用户满意度
建议采用分布式追踪技术,为每个任务生成唯一ID,实现全链路监控。
四、未来演进方向:智能体即服务(Agent-as-a-Service)
随着企业数字化转型深入,MoltBot架构正在向云原生智能体平台演进:
- 多模型编排:支持不同模型在任务链中的协同工作
- 自适应约束:根据运行数据动态调整约束策略
- 智能体市场:构建可共享的任务模板和适配器生态
- 安全沙箱:提供完全隔离的执行环境保障数据安全
某云厂商的测试环境显示,新一代架构使智能体开发效率提升5倍,运维成本降低70%,真正实现AI能力的开箱即用。
结语:重新定义AI工程化边界
MoltBot的实践证明,通过合理的架构设计,大语言模型完全可以从”对话玩具”进化为”业务引擎”。其核心价值不在于创造了新的算法,而在于构建了连接模型能力与业务需求的标准化桥梁。对于开发者而言,掌握这种工程化思维,将是把握AI 2.0时代机遇的关键能力。